Transaction 5e09386382af83a11779824e6667714bf8c0522a1fef56c3f995cbeb8d20f6e1
1 Input
1 Output
-
5e09386382af83a11779824e6667714bf8c0522a1fef56c3f995cbeb8d20f6e1:0
- value
- 51375180
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c52ea69534ded52b9f7c34f67e8aac9776433ac
- address
- bc1q33fw562nfhk49w0hcd8k0692e9mkgvav9vlnm7